The US State Department recently raised the travel alert level for Jamaica. This has caused confusion for the essential travel and tourism industry in Jamaica, but also in the United States.
U.S, Feb. 17 -- US Under Secretary of State for Civilian Security, Democracy, and Human Rights Uzra Zeya will travel to Kingston, Jamaica, and Belmopan, Belize from February 19-23, 2024, to advance bilateral and regional cooperation on civilian security, migration, and human rights.
Tourism may not be on top of her mind when visiting Jamaica, but it may be on top of the agenda for Jamaica Tourism Stakeholders, concerned about the current US travel advisory hurting this essential income for one of the most successful destinations in the global travel and tourism world.
This visit is scheduled just after UN Tourism is celebrating UN Tourism Resilience Day in Jamaica on February 17.
